Asia Corporate Jet in Singapore Adds First Gulfstream G550

Asia Corporate Jet has expanded its fleet with the addition of its first Gulfstream G550, according to ch-aviation research. The aircraft, registered as VP-CWZ in the Cayman Islands, is 13.8 years old and was previously registered in the United States as N61WZ. It is not listed as a Part 135-certified aircraft.
The G550 was last active on February 18, 2025, operating a flight between Kuala Lumpur Subang and Singapore Seletar, where it remains based. The aircraft first flew under the VP-CWZ registration on March 14, 2025, departing for Johor Bahru for a series of test flights before returning to Singapore Seletar.
This new addition to Asia Corporate Jet’s fleet complements its two Gulfstream G450s, which are both 13.6 years old. One of the G450s is available for charter under the company’s Cayman AOC, while the other is privately operated.
